Responsibilitie Topic Content: Multimodal Foundation Models for Intelligent Multimedia Processing Explore next-generation multimedia technologies powered by multimodal foundation models, including perceptual quality modeling, generative enhancement, temporal video understanding, user-centric evaluation, and intelligent visual representation/compression, to advance video quality, efficiency, and user experience in future multimedia systems. Challenges for smart video coding and representation: - Achieving much higher compression efficiency than current encoders - Keeping complexity and power use within acceptable limits - Ensuring encoding and decoding work smoothly across different platforms - Efficiently compressing new types of smart data like tokens - Effectively representing semantic information Research value of smart video coding and representation: - Traditional video coding is reaching its limit. Smart video coding can go beyond these limits and achieve much better video compression. - New types of smart data, like tokens, will use more bandwidth in future applications. Compressing these data will greatly improve how videos are transmitted and stored. - If smart video coding and representation become a standard, they will quickly gain market share and have big potential for valuable patents. - Efficient smart video coding and representation can save a lot of bandwidth and storage, directly creating financial gains.
